Nice, I quite liked Mustang / Bronco. Most didn't stay in operation to the end of there useful life as the Solid State era started and mentality quickly become an SS or I change to an operator that will supply me an SS.

 

This vintage Gottlieb were boxed up and warehoused. I remember seeing hundreds in one warehouse owned by Goddards in Ultimo where they stayed till LAI bought the lot when they bought Goddards.

 

They reappeared several years later and were sold off to the public at usually around $100 for single players, $200 for a twin player and $3-400 for a four player.

 

Two of my mates and I were doing weekend work for one such seller of these machines on Parramatta Road. We would pull them out of the boxes and power the machines up. Surprisingly most booted straight up, were quickly cleaned and put in a showroom where the public would come in and buy them.

 

That guy was selling around 30 each day over the weekend and many times was selling them as we wheeled them out from the workshop into the showroom.

 

We were getting paid $20 a machine, something I laugh about now as I write this but in those days $100 a week was an average week's wage and we could knock out 20 machines a day between the three of us.

2 coats of water based enamel applied,

Stencils cut out by the vinyl cutter

 

head3.thumb.JPG.d78e824bcfe44fba850aefe55052f20f.JPG

Lined up with the trace paper

 

head4.thumb.JPG.b4873587c2537e494cffc6a81cb86461.JPG

 

Then hand drawn onto the head

 

head5.thumb.JPG.6f260c88a884cbb74e9ba1fd63e86e6a.JPG

 

head6.thumb.JPG.264093523d95cb3b1ee94be75c5ead8c.JPG

 

The cut out self adhesive vinyl is then applied.

 

head7.thumb.jpg.4d623164c674095a85bfaee412b05000.jpg

 

head8.thumb.JPG.52e84eaa331fe65286b06e4d36368d98.JPG

 

Most important part - apply primer/sealer paint over the area to minimize paint bleed.

Ready for first colour - Red
